J.A. López-Sáez is a scholar working on Biomaterials, Plant Science and Paleontology. According to data from OpenAlex, J.A. López-Sáez has authored 6 papers receiving a total of 160 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Biomaterials, 2 papers in Plant Science and 1 paper in Paleontology. Recurrent topics in J.A. López-Sáez's work include Phytochemistry and Bioactive Compounds (2 papers), Phytochemistry and Biological Activities (2 papers) and Tree-ring climate responses (1 paper). J.A. López-Sáez is often cited by papers focused on Phytochemistry and Bioactive Compounds (2 papers), Phytochemistry and Biological Activities (2 papers) and Tree-ring climate responses (1 paper). J.A. López-Sáez collaborates with scholars based in Spain, Germany and Switzerland. J.A. López-Sáez's co-authors include Sebastián Pérez Díaz, Didier Galop, María José Pérez‐Alonso, Arturo Velasco‐Negueruela, Mario Morellón, Ana Moreno, Ana Pérez-Sanz, Sergi Pla‐Rabès, Juan Pablo Corella and Enrique Serrano and has published in prestigious journals such as Scientific Reports, Quaternary International and Climate of the past.
